Alright guys i need some help, i have about $2000 to spend and im looking for a solid 300 hp to the wheels and would like to run low 13's high 12's. I currently have a set of gt-40p heads but am thinking of selling them, i also have 3.73's, edelbrock performer intake, march pulleys, and frpp short tubes. My car is and 89 5-speed hatch stock weight. What would you guys recommend? I need the max amount to be no more than 2000 so everything i need to intall a set of heads or whatever you guys recommend. let me know what you think. would a set of ported p heads net me 300 to the wheels? i mean i have seen some people close but i would like an almost gaurnteed 300hp with the combo I choose. Whatever combo i choose i will more than likely get a custom cam made by Ed Curtis if funds work out that way. The problem with buying a set of aluminum heads is that for most all i will need a set of hardened pushrods, rockers, better springs locks and retainers. o i almost forgot, In stock form i ran a best of 14.5 at 96mph on crappy all season tires. What does everyone think?

You can definately run some good times with the P heads and a nice cam to match them...You can definatley spend your money on the suspension and that alone will allow you to hit low 13's or even high 12's even though you may not be at your 300HP mark...There's lots of combos out there and there is no best setup up...it all depends how deep your pocket is and how expensive of a combo you want...
 
do you want this performance just at the strip, and not constant for DD?
If that is the case i would say a 75 shot of nitrous, a good set a slicks, a new driveshaft (to handle slicks), and suspension (control arms, trac bars, ect.).
If you go this route you would probably need a new shifter, and that would barely break the $2000 mark.
 
sorry guys forgot to say i would like to go N/A and would like some nice power on the street also. but what is the risk in buying a used charger? should i port the stock heads then? how safe is it with the stock bottom end? i never though about going that route, but what do you guys think, na power wise
 
I don't know about anyone else, but I was talking N/A. A set of P-heads, Intake, and exhaust - with gears and a 5-speed should run low 13's, or even 12's if you run slicks. You don't need to make 5-zillion horsepower to run those times.
